文件名称:Yush.java.tar
-
所属分类:
- 标签属性:
- 上传时间:2016-04-07
-
文件大小:878byte
-
已下载:0次
-
提 供 者:
-
相关连接:无下载说明:别用迅雷下载,失败请重下,重下不扣分!
介绍说明--下载内容来自于网络,使用问题请自行百度
This a new algorithm in which we encrypt on the basis of position of the character.
Algorithm 1 for key generation and Algorithm 2 is for encryption
Algorithm A1
Step1: Let the key be ‘k’.
Step2: Multiply the index number +1 with its ASCII code of the character at that index-65.
Step3: Sum all the values and mod 26.
Step4: Return the key.
Algorithm A2
Step1: Take the string which you want to encrypt.
Step2: Find the number of spaces.
Step3: We add 65 to number of space.
Step4: Take a string s.
Step5: Add character representing number of spaces to that string.
Step6: Calculate the word length of all the words present in the string and 65 to it.
Step7: Now append the character that represents the word length.
Step8: Subtract the number 1 and Add the number 1 with the ASCII value of the characters at alternate position.
Step9: Add the key to each character in the string.
Step10: Subtract 65 and the value so obtained modulo 26.
Step11: Cipher text obtained.-This is a new algorithm in which we encrypt on the basis of position of the character.
Algorithm 1 for key generation and Algorithm 2 is for encryption
Algorithm A1
Step1: Let the key be ‘k’.
Step2: Multiply the index number +1 with its ASCII code of the character at that index-65.
Step3: Sum all the values and mod 26.
Step4: Return the key.
Algorithm A2
Step1: Take the string which you want to encrypt.
Step2: Find the number of spaces.
Step3: We add 65 to number of space.
Step4: Take a string s.
Step5: Add character representing number of spaces to that string.
Step6: Calculate the word length of all the words present in the string and 65 to it.
Step7: Now append the character that represents the word length.
Step8: Subtract the number 1 and Add the number 1 with the ASCII value of the characters at alternate position.
Step9: Add the key to each character in the string.
Step10: Subtract 65 and the value so obtained modulo 26.
Step11: Cipher text obtained.
Algorithm 1 for key generation and Algorithm 2 is for encryption
Algorithm A1
Step1: Let the key be ‘k’.
Step2: Multiply the index number +1 with its ASCII code of the character at that index-65.
Step3: Sum all the values and mod 26.
Step4: Return the key.
Algorithm A2
Step1: Take the string which you want to encrypt.
Step2: Find the number of spaces.
Step3: We add 65 to number of space.
Step4: Take a string s.
Step5: Add character representing number of spaces to that string.
Step6: Calculate the word length of all the words present in the string and 65 to it.
Step7: Now append the character that represents the word length.
Step8: Subtract the number 1 and Add the number 1 with the ASCII value of the characters at alternate position.
Step9: Add the key to each character in the string.
Step10: Subtract 65 and the value so obtained modulo 26.
Step11: Cipher text obtained.-This is a new algorithm in which we encrypt on the basis of position of the character.
Algorithm 1 for key generation and Algorithm 2 is for encryption
Algorithm A1
Step1: Let the key be ‘k’.
Step2: Multiply the index number +1 with its ASCII code of the character at that index-65.
Step3: Sum all the values and mod 26.
Step4: Return the key.
Algorithm A2
Step1: Take the string which you want to encrypt.
Step2: Find the number of spaces.
Step3: We add 65 to number of space.
Step4: Take a string s.
Step5: Add character representing number of spaces to that string.
Step6: Calculate the word length of all the words present in the string and 65 to it.
Step7: Now append the character that represents the word length.
Step8: Subtract the number 1 and Add the number 1 with the ASCII value of the characters at alternate position.
Step9: Add the key to each character in the string.
Step10: Subtract 65 and the value so obtained modulo 26.
Step11: Cipher text obtained.
(系统自动生成,下载前可以参看下载内容)
下载文件列表
Yush.java
本网站为编程资源及源代码搜集、介绍的搜索网站,版权归原作者所有! 粤ICP备11031372号
1999-2046 搜珍网 All Rights Reserved.